Redis 服务设置批处理文件
对于比较懒的人,批处理绝对是一个很友好的东西,一次编码,终生受用。
日常使用Redis,犹豫需要搭配对应的config文件,所以每次命令上编写都比较麻烦
因此考虑使用批处理的方式进行统一
首先是,将Redis安装为windows服务,然后启动服务的批处理
:: %1 mshta vbscript:CreateObject("WScript.Shell").Run("%~s0 ::",0,FALSE)(window.close)&&exit :: 切换到本地执行路径 cd %~dp0 redis-server --service-install redis.windows-service.conf --service-name redis-6379 redis-server --service-install redis.windows-sentinel.conf --sentinel --service-name redis-sentinel-6379 :: 切换系统命令执行路径 cd %SystemRoot%\system32 net start redis-6379 net start redis-sentinel-6379 pause
然后是,将Redis对应的服务停止,并删掉
:: %1 mshta vbscript:CreateObject("WScript.Shell").Run("%~s0 ::",0,FALSE)(window.close)&&exit :: 切换系统命令执行路径 cd %SystemRoot%\system32 net stop redis-6379 net stop redis-sentinel-6379 :: 切换到本地执行路径 cd %~dp0 redis-server.exe --service-uninstall --service-name redis-6379 redis-server.exe --service-uninstall --service-name redis-sentinel-6379 pause